Another myth is that boxing gyms are inherently dangerous places prone to frequent injuries. In reality, professional facilities prioritize safety heavily. Proper warm-ups, technique coaching, and appropriate protective gear minimize risks significantly. Injuries often occur due to poor form or ignoring safety rules, issues that exist in any sport or exercise modality. Understanding this helps demystify the experience.
A further misconception involves the exclusivity of the skill sets offered. Some people assume that boxing training is only for those who want to compete in the ring. This is far from accurate. The vast majority of attendees use boxing for general fitness, stress management, and coordination development. The techniques learned, such as pivoting, rotating, and controlled breathing, have applications in daily life and other sports.
